Boasting rich biodiversity and a beautiful natural environment, Fuli Township has promoted eco-friendly organic farming for many years. It is a member of the International Partnership for the Satoyama Initiative (IPSI) and the first region in Taiwan to receive the prestigious "Class Special-A" certification from Japan's Paddy Field Environment Assessment. The township features approximately 2,500 hectares of paddy fields, 200 hectares of daylilies, 60 hectares of bamboo forests, 50 hectares of plum trees, and about 50 hectares allocated for other crops such as tea, coffee, and soybeans.
The creative philosophy behind the Fuli Straw Art Festival focuses on repurposing agricultural straw waste and passing down the near-forgotten local craft of bamboo weaving, transforming these materials into boundless, imaginative artworks. Grounded in the circular economy and the spirit of the Satoyama Initiative, the festival emphasizes "harmonious coexistence with nature," aiming to introduce visitors to the various creatures that share rural farm life through these artistic creations.
Emphasizing the core concept of "co-creating landscapes with farmers," the Fuli Farmers' Association collaborated with domestic bamboo artists and universities starting from the festival's inaugural year. By involving local villages and schools in the creative process, the annual event now draws over a million visitors. This has not only stimulated the development of local leisure industries but has also established the Straw Art Festival as the most significant community celebration for the people of Fuli.
